分享好友 数智知识首页 数智知识分类 切换频道

自动化机器编程用什么软件比较好

自动化机器编程是现代制造业和工业自动化中不可或缺的一部分,它涉及到使用编程语言来控制机器人、机械臂或其他自动化设备。选择合适的软件工具对于确保高效、准确地编程至关重要。以下是一些广泛使用的自动化机器编程软件。...
2025-04-16 20:48150

自动化机器编程是现代制造业和工业自动化中不可或缺的一部分,它涉及到使用编程语言来控制机器人、机械臂或其他自动化设备。选择合适的软件工具对于确保高效、准确地编程至关重要。以下是一些广泛使用的自动化机器编程软件:

1. Robot Operating System (ROS): ROS是一个开源的框架,广泛用于机器人操作系统的开发。它支持多种编程语言,如C++、Python、Java等,并提供了一套完整的工具集用于创建、管理和运行ROS应用程序。ROS的优势在于其灵活性和可扩展性,能够适应各种复杂的机器人系统。

2. Robot Developer Kit (RDK): RDK是一个由ABB开发的集成开发环境,专为ABB的机器人而设计。它提供了一系列工具,包括图形化编程界面、代码生成器和调试工具,使得编程过程更加直观和高效。RDK特别适合那些熟悉ABB机器人的用户。

3. Siemens Mindsphere: Siemens Mindsphere是一个综合性的工业物联网平台,它不仅支持机器人编程,还提供了一整套解决方案,包括设备管理、数据分析和云计算服务。Mindsphere提供了一个用户友好的界面,使得非技术用户也能够轻松地与机器人交互。

4. Bosch Rexroth RAPID: Bosch Rexroth RAPID是一个专门为Rexroth机器人设计的编程软件。它以其直观的图形界面和强大的功能而受到许多工程师的喜爱。RAPID支持多种编程语言,并且能够与Rexroth机器人的硬件紧密集成。

5. Siemens S7-HMI: Siemens S7-HMI是一款专门为西门子PLC和HMI设备设计的编程软件。它提供了一套完整的工具,用于编写、编译和调试西门子PLC程序。S7-HMI适用于需要与西门子控制系统交互的场景。

自动化机器编程用什么软件比较好

6. ABB Ability Studio: ABB Ability Studio是一个全面的软件开发套件,专为ABB机器人和自动化系统设计。它提供了一系列的开发工具,包括编辑器、编译器、调试器和模拟器,以及一系列预构建的解决方案,可以加快开发流程。

选择适合的自动化机器编程软件时,应考虑以下因素:

1. 语言支持:确定软件是否支持您将要使用的编程语言。

2. 易用性:软件是否提供直观的用户界面和易于理解的文档。

3. 社区和支持:一个活跃的社区和可靠的技术支持对于解决编程过程中的问题至关重要。

4. 兼容性:软件是否能够与您的其他系统集成,或者是否支持与其他设备的通信。

5. 成本:软件许可费用和维护成本也是决策的重要因素。

总之,在选择自动化机器编程软件时,建议进行彻底的研究和比较,以确保选择最适合您项目需求的工具。

举报
收藏 0
推荐产品更多
蓝凌MK

智能、协同、安全、高效蓝凌MK数智化工作平台全面支撑组织数智化可持续发展Gartner预测,组装式企业在实施新功能方面能力超80%竞争对手。未来,企业亟需基于“封装业务能力”(Packaged Business Capability,简称PBC)理念,将传统OA及业务系统全面升级为组...

帆软FineBI

数据分析,一气呵成数据准备可连接多种数据源,一键接入数据库表或导入Excel数据编辑可视化编辑数据,过滤合并计算,完全不需要SQL数据可视化内置50+图表和联动钻取特效,可视化呈现数据故事分享协作可多人协同编辑仪表板,复用他人报表,一键分享发布比传统...

悟空CRM

为什么客户选择悟空CRM?悟空CRM为您提供全方位服务客户管理的主要功能客户管理,把控全局悟空CRM助力销售全流程,通过对客户初始信息、跟进过程、 关联商机、合同等的全流程管理,与客户建立紧密的联系, 帮助销售统筹规划每一步,赢得强有力的竞争力优势。...

简道云

丰富模板,安装即用200+应用模板,既提供标准化管理方案,也支持零代码个性化修改低成本、快速地搭建企业级管理应用通过功能组合,灵活实现数据在不同场景下的:采集-流转-处理-分析应用表单个性化通过对字段拖拉拽或导入Excel表,快速生成一张表单,灵活进行...

推荐知识更多